Complete Buying Guide for Best Convertible Car Seat For Air Travel

Essential Factors We Consider

When searching for the best convertible car seat for air travel, prioritize weight, ease of installation, and FAA approval. A lighter seat is much easier to carry, while a slim profile ensures it fits securely on standard airplane seats. Always check for the FAA-approved label, which is required if you plan to use the seat during the flight.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Are all convertible car seats allowed on airplanes?

A: Most car seats are FAA-approved, but you must look for the official “This restraint is certified for use in motor vehicles and aircraft” sticker on the seat. Always check the manufacturer’s documentation.

Q: Should I bring my own car seat or rent one?

A: Bringing your own is safer as you know the history of the seat. Rental car seats may have been in accidents or handled poorly, so using your own gives you total control.

Q: Can I check my car seat as baggage?

A: Yes, you can check it for free on most airlines, but using a heavy-duty padded bag is recommended to prevent damage during the transit process.
